Channel 4's Alternative Election Night to return

...plus a Last Leg special

Channel 4’s Alternative Election Night is to return, with David Mitchell, Richard Osman and Jeremy Paxman.

The June 8 show will also feature Channel 4 News presenters Cathy Newman and Gary Gibbon reporting on the results.

In 2015, Channel 4’s Alternative Election Night was the most watched election night coverage on commercial TV, achieving a peak audience of 2.4million at 10pm, as polls closed.

The broadcaster has also announced that The  Last Leg will have a live two-hour post-election special, with Adam Hills, Alex Brooker and Josh Widdicombe and guests.

The whole series was brought forward to ensure that the channel’s flagship topical satire show was on air during the campaign.

Channel 4 is also hosting a joint programme with Sky News, May v Corbyn Live: The Battle for Number 10, in which Jeremy Paxman will interview the Prime Minister and Labour leader separately.
